PREVIEW: CHENNAI SUPER KINGS IN QUALIFIER 2- MAY 25, 2012



Just a week back Chennai Super Kings- the two times IPL champion was almost dead! When the other three competitors were struggling for the playoffs, they were almost out of the playoffs. However, fortune smiled on them. The strongest competitor lost their last match, which ensured the fourth position for Chennai in the playoffs. Throughout the group matches, this team played in an underrated way but their luck favored a lot to get qualified in the playoffs.

Being in the playoffs, yesterday, Chennai played against Mumbai in the Eliminator match where they smashed their rival and got an impressive victory of 38 runs. So, to be in the final Chennai boys have to go through another round and that is the Qualifier 2 match. In this match, Chennai will confront Qualifier 1 loser Delhi Daredevils on May 25, 2012. This match has been scheduled at MA Chidambaram Stadium, Chennai from 8.00 PM IST.

At this stage of IPL 2012, something unexpected is happening. After a marvelous innings throughout this tournament, when Delhi’s position was almost confirmed in the final, Kolkata defeated Delhi in Qualifier 1 match. On the other hand, Chennai has been an underrated team compared to other playoff teams but they managed to play an electrifying innings in the Eliminator match against Mumbai to move up to Qualifier 2. In their last match against Mumbai Indians, till 15 over, Chennai managed to get only 114 runs for 5 wickets and that too mainly for two superb innings from Badrinath and Hussey. Then Captain Dhoni took the responsibility to give a boost to the team score to 187 along with Dwayne Bravo.  This unbroken partnership came up with 73 runs from only 29 balls.

Besides these batsmen, bowlers have also done a miracle in the pitch by taking up quick wickets. Bravo and Morkel were superb last night and the silent but one of the most attacking performer, Hilfenhaus has done a great job throughout the innings. He has taken 11 wickets from 7 matches in this IPL. Ashwin is the most reliable bowler with an average economy rate of 6.32.

This superb combination of batting and bowling squad has done a great job for this team which has moved Chennai team one step closer to the IPL 2012 final. Chennai supporters are expecting another such marvelous innings from their favourite team players tomorrow which would open the door for them to the final.

Probable team players for Chennai Super Kings: MS Dhoni (c & wk), Michael Hussey, Murali Vijay, S Badrinath, Suresh Raina, Ravindra Jadeja, Dwayne Bravo, Albie Morkel, Shadab Jakati, Ravichandran Ashwin, Ben Hilfenhaus.
